Chimney Sweeping in Contra Costa County, CA
Chimney sweeping services involve the thorough cleaning of a chimney’s interior to remove soot, creosote buildup, and debris that can accumulate over time. This process helps maintain proper airflow and reduces the risk of fire hazards, ensuring that fireplaces, wood stoves, and other vented appliances operate safely and efficiently. Property owners often request chimney sweeping when preparing for the heating season, after noticing reduced draft or smoke backup, or following a chimney inspection that reveals buildup or obstructions. The service typically covers cleaning all accessible parts of the chimney, including the flue, firebox, and chimney cap, to promote optimal performance and safety.
Before requesting chimney sweeping, homeowners usually want to understand what the service includes and whether additional repairs or inspections are recommended. It’s helpful to know if the service will identify potential issues such as cracks, blockages, or damage that may require further attention. Property owners should also inquire about the cleaning process, the tools used, and any preparations needed before the work begins. Proper maintenance through regular chimney sweeping can extend the lifespan of the chimney system and help prevent costly repairs or dangerous situations caused by creosote fires or blockages.

Common Chimney Sweeping Jobs
Chimney Cleaning - removal of soot, creosote, and debris to ensure safe and efficient operation.
Chimney Inspection - thorough assessment of the flue, firebox, and chimney structure for damage or blockages.
Chimney Sweeping - comprehensive cleaning to prevent buildup that can cause chimney fires or ventilation issues.
Chimney Maintenance - routine services to keep the chimney in proper working condition and extend its lifespan.
Chimney Repair - fixing cracks, damaged liners, or other issues that compromise safety and performance.
Chimney Cap Installation - fitting protective caps to prevent debris, animals, and water from entering the chimney.
Chimney Sweeping Questions
How often should a chimney be swept? It is recommended to have the chimney inspected and swept at least once a year to ensure safe and efficient operation.
What signs indicate a chimney needs cleaning? Common signs include smoke backup, a strong odor, or visible soot and creosote buildup inside the chimney.
Does chimney sweeping improve fireplace performance? Yes, regular cleaning can enhance airflow and reduce the risk of fire hazards, leading to better fireplace performance.
What types of chimneys can be serviced? Chimney sweeping services typically cover wood-burning, gas, and pellet stove chimneys, among other types.
